CERN, the European Organization for Nuclear Research, was established in 1954 and is one of the world's largest and most respected centers for scientific research. It employs over 2,500 staff members and has a diverse workforce from more than 100 nationalities. CERN operates in multiple countries, primarily in Europe, and is known for its groundbreaking research in particle physics, utilizing the world's largest and most complex scientific instruments to explore the fundamental structure of the universe. Job Overview:
The Mechanical Engineer position within the Mechanical and Materials Engineering (EN-MME) group at CERN involves significant contributions to the design, simulation, and optimization of CO2 cooling transfer lines as part of the CMS detector upgrade. The role requires performing thermo-mechanical analyses using finite element analysis tools like ANSYS, alongside structural and thermal calculations that adhere to relevant standards. The successful candidate will engage in iterative design development to achieve performance objectives while addressing integration constraints. Collaboration with engineers, designers, and technicians across various domains is essential, as is the preparation of comprehensive technical documentation throughout the project lifecycle. This position is critical for ensuring the successful implementation of engineering solutions that meet the project's requirements.
